WebSep 4, 2024 · The peripheral nervous system (PNS) consists of all the nervous tissue that lies outside of the central nervous system (CNS). The main function of the PNS is to connect the CNS to the rest of the organism. It serves as a communication relay, going back and forth between the CNS and muscles, organs, and glands throughout the body. WebThe peripheral nervous system is divided into the somatic and autonomic nervous systems. The somatic nervous system delivers voluntary nerve impulses from the brain to other parts of the body including face and appendages. The autonomic nervous system is in control of involuntary physiological functions like digestion and heart rate. civics for all doe

WebThe peripheral nervous system is a channel for the relay of sensory and motor impulses between the central nervous system on one hand and the body surface, skeletal muscles, and internal organs on the other hand. It is composed of (1) spinal nerves, (2) cranial nerves, and (3) certain parts of the autonomic nervous system. As in the central nervous system, … douglas county sch district 1 omaha ne
